Edenred adds Free2move to its Ticket Mobilité partner network to help employees with their commutes

Free2move, a major, leading player in mobility, has joined the Ticket Mobilité partner network, among 150+ mobility providers, run by Edenred, the leader in digital specific-purpose payment solutions (like Ticket Restaurant®, Ticket Mobilité, Kadéos and Télétravail Edenred) in France and worldwide. Users of the Edenred Ticket Mobilité solution can now take advantage of Free2move's fully digital car-sharing service, offering electric vehicles for short-distance urban travel and sustainable mobility.

Ticket Mobilité works just like the Ticket Restaurant meal benefit, only for commuting. It gives employees a simple way to have up to €600 per year of their commuting costs covered by their employer.

Edenred's Ticket Mobilité solution is a fully digital account that comes with a payment card and a mobile app. In line with France's November 2019 mobility law (Loi d'Orientation des Mobilités Act), it can be used to pay for new sustainable and shared transportation options, introduced by the sustainable mobility allowance like cycling and car-sharing, as well as for fuel (gasoline/diesel and electricity). The Ticket Mobilité account, whose use is governed by the new mobility law, can be fully customized to fit the needs of each business.

Thanks to the new partnership between Edenred and Free2move, employees can now pay for their Free2move subscription with the Ticket Mobilité card.

Jean-Cyrille Girardin, Merchant Services Director at Edenred France, said: "Edenred is looking to create the market's most comprehensive commuting ecosystem to help French employees every day as they move to accessible, green mobility. We're delighted to have formed this new partnership with Free2move, which will allow our users to reduce transportation-related CO2 emissions."

Elodie Picand, Marketing & Sales Director at Free2move, said: "Given our commitment to making electric mobility accessible to all for everyday use, we're proud to offer Edenred Ticket Mobilité clients the option to use our 600 electric vehicles - by the minute, by the hour or by the day."

Thanks to the Free2move service, employees can enjoy almost instant access to more than 600 electric vehicles, including the compact, agile and all-electric Citroën AMI. The Free2move fleet, available in Paris and certain suburbs, is perfectly suited to city trips.
